Taiwan looks to Jakim for help to boost halal industry

Only five certification bodies check on the halal status of food products, restaurants and logistics in Taiwan. – The Malaysian Insight file pic, April 19, 2019.

TAIWAN aspires to have more of its halal certification bodies gain recognition from the Islamic Development Department Malaysia to cater for the ever-expanding halal certification demand. David Hsu, director of the economic division of the Taipei Economic and Cultural Office in Malaysia, said the organisations needed more guidance from Malaysia on the halal industry criteria as guidelines for product operators who planned to venture into the market.
